PENSACOLA, Fla. (WKRG) — Florida Attorney General James Uthmeier has sent a letter to the Pensacola City Council over a drag show taking place at the Saenger Theatre two days before Christmas.
According to Uthmeier, "A Drag Queen Christmas" makes fun of a holiday that is sacred to Christians.
"It has been referred to as part of the 'Naughty Tour,' where men masquerading as women claim to put the 'Ho Ho Ho Into The Holidays'," read the letter.
The letter cites the contract between the city and the management company, Legends Global, stating that the city has the right to cancel the event for a variety of reasons.
However, city officials said they did not see the event as a risk to the public.
